      Honestly,it's because that gloss primer is rubbish. Dries into glossy but grainy surface which is not suitable for profi metalic finishes. Maybe different primer would help (but that would be a lacquer one) or just don't use it at all. Chrome or duraluminium are really great for waterbased acrylics and here is how I used them for nice metalic surface: 1. Prepare the plastic - smooth it with sanding sponge to at least 3000 grit. 2. Mix the paint with one drop of Vallejo flow improver. 3. Set the low pressure (optional) 4. Spray it in very light passes.

      I've been using the Gunmetal Grey with a brush, and it goes on really well. Just build it up in a few thin coats, and give the paint on your palette a stir every few minutes to stop the pigment and metal flakes from separating.
